Hartkopf, Volker Hugo was born on January 15, 1940 in Stuttgart, Federal Republic of Germany. Son of Alfred Gustav and Hedwig (Wahl) Hartkopf. came to the United States, 1970.
Diploma, University Stuttgart, 1969. Doctor of Philosophy, University Stuttgart, 1990. Master of Architecture, University Texas, 1972.
Private practice, Ludwigsburg, Federal Republic of Germany, 1965-1969;
project designer, Siegel Wonneberg Architects, Stuttgart, 1969-1970;
assistant professor, North Dakota State University, Fargo, 1971-1972;
from assistant to associate professor, Carnegie Mellon U., Pittsburgh, 1972-1981;
professor, Carnegie Mellon U., Pittsburgh, since 1981;
director, Carnegie Mellon U., Pittsburgh, since 1983. Lecturer U. Stuttgart, 1969-1970. Member scientific mission to Romania National Science Foundation,1985.
Member White House Conference on Energy and Urban Redevelopment, 1979. Principal investigator Redevelopment Research and Demonstration, Bangladesh. Projectdir. Energy Conserving Low Income Housing, 1981-1985, Earthquake Resistant Construction, Peru, 1979.
Speaker on housing, energy, and total building performance of advanced workplaces.
Member organizing committee Remaking Cities Conference, Pittsburgh, 1988, chairman workshop, 1988. Member Bicentennial Committee for Allegheny County, Pittsburgh, 1988-1990. Chairman faculty senate Carnegie Mellon University, 1989-1990.
Member American Society for Testing and Materials (founder committee on whole building performance), Institute Light and Building (trustee 1991), Architecktenkammer, Integrated Construction Institute, Intelligent Building Institute, United States Club of Rome, Advanced Building Systems Integration Consortium (founder 1988).
Married Elisabeth Rauschmaier, June 25, 1965 (divorced 1967). 1 child, Kathrin; married Vivian Loftness, September 12, 1981. Children: Sophia, Nicholas, Alessandra.
